Plan Costs:

The cost of a Medicare Advantage Plan is made up of four main parts.

  • First, the monthly premium — the amount you pay every month.
  • Second, the deductible — the amount you pay out of pocket for covered services before the plan starts paying.
  • Third, the copayments and coinsurance — the amounts you pay out of pocket for covered services, usually after meeting the deductible (if applicable). Copays are fixed dollar amounts; coinsurance is a percentage of the cost.
  • Fourth, the Out-of-Pocket Maximum — the maximum amount you could have to pay out of pocket in a year. This may be different for in-network and out-of-network services.

Additional Benefits IconAdditional Benefits

The Humana USAA Honor Giveback (Regional PPO) offers robust medical coverage with no copays for primary care visits, home health services, and standard preventive care. Specialist office visits require a $40 copay, while inpatient hospital stays carry a $425 daily copay for the first five days with no coinsurance. Emergency care is accessible with a $130 copay, and urgent care visits require a $50 copay. For dental, vision, and hearing needs, the plan provides generous benefits including a $4,000 annual dental limit with no copay for most services. Routine eye exams, eyewear, and over-the-counter hearing aids also feature no copay, though prescription hearing aids carry a copay between $699 and $999. Other services, such as durable medical equipment and dialysis, are covered with a 20% coinsurance.

Inpatient Hospital See details

Humana USAA Honor Giveback (Regional PPO) partially covers inpatient hospital stays with no coinsurance, requiring a $425 copay for days 1 to 5 (and no copay for days 6 to 999) for acute care, and a $370 copay for days 1 to 5 (and no copay for days 6 to 90) for psychiatric care. Upgrades, non-Medicare-covered stays, and additional psychiatric days are not covered.

Outpatient Services See details

Humana USAA Honor Giveback (Regional PPO) covers outpatient services with no coinsurance, though copays vary depending on the specific service. Patients will pay a copay of $0 to $350 for outpatient hospital services and $425 per stay for observation services, while ambulatory surgical center, outpatient blood, and outpatient substance abuse services have no copay.

Partial Hospitalization See details

Partial hospitalization benefits are covered by the Humana USAA Honor Giveback (Regional PPO) with a $35.00 copay and no coinsurance. Prior authorization is required to receive these services.

Ambulance and Transportation Services See details

Humana USAA Honor Giveback (Regional PPO) partially covers ambulance and transportation services, as transportation services to plan-approved or any health-related locations are not covered. Covered ground ambulance services require a $335 copay and no coinsurance, while air ambulance services require a 20% coinsurance and no copay, with prior authorization required.

Emergency Services See details

Humana USAA Honor Giveback (Regional PPO) covers emergency services with a $130 copay and urgent care with a $50 copay, both with no coinsurance. Worldwide emergency, urgent, and transportation services are also covered with a $130 copay and no coinsurance.

Primary Care See details

Humana USAA Honor Giveback (Regional PPO) covers primary care physician visits, mental health, psychiatric, and opioid treatment services with no copay and no coinsurance, though podiatry services are not covered. Chiropractic services are partially covered, excluding routine chiropractic care, while specialist visits require a $40 copay, therapy services require a $35 copay, and telehealth services range from a $0 to $50 copay, all with no coinsurance.

Preventive Services See details

Humana USAA Honor Giveback (Regional PPO) covers preventive services, including annual physical exams, kidney disease education, and select screenings, with no copay or coinsurance. Additional preventive services are only partially covered; while a memory fitness program is included at no cost, sub-services such as health education, weight management, and personal emergency response systems are not covered.

Hearing Services See details

Hearing services are covered by the Humana USAA Honor Giveback (Regional PPO) with no deductible and no coinsurance, though they are partially covered since inner ear, outer ear, and over the ear prescription hearing aids are not covered. Routine exams, fitting evaluations, and OTC hearing aids have no copay, while Medicare-covered exams require a $40 copay and covered prescription hearing aids carry a $699 to $999 copay.

Vision Services See details

The Humana USAA Honor Giveback (Regional PPO) plan partially covers vision services with no coinsurance, offering eye exams with copays ranging from no copay to $40 and covered eyewear with no copay. While routine eye exams, contact lenses, and eyeglasses (lenses and frames) are covered, separate eyeglass lenses, eyeglass frames, and upgrades are not covered.

Dental Services See details

Dental services are partially covered by the Humana USAA Honor Giveback (Regional PPO) up to a $4,000 annual limit, featuring no copay or coinsurance for most preventive and comprehensive services. Medicare-covered dental requires a $40 copay with no coinsurance, fixed and removable prosthodontics have a 30% coinsurance with no copay, and fluoride treatments, maxillofacial prosthetics, implant services, and orthodontics are not covered.

Home Infusion bundled Services See details

Humana USAA Honor Giveback (Regional PPO) covers home infusion bundled services with prior authorization. Covered Medicare Part B insulin drugs require a $35 copay and no coinsurance to 20% coinsurance, while chemotherapy and other Part B drugs require no copay and no coinsurance to 20% coinsurance.

Dialysis Services See details

Humana USAA Honor Giveback (Regional PPO) covers dialysis services with a 20% coinsurance and no copay. Prior authorization is required to receive coverage for these services.

Medical Equipment See details

Humana USAA Honor Giveback (Regional PPO) covers durable medical equipment (DME) with no copay and 20% coinsurance, and prosthetics and medical supplies with 20% coinsurance. Diabetic supplies feature no copay and 10% to 20% coinsurance, while diabetic shoes and inserts require a $10 copay, with prior authorization required for these medical equipment benefits.

Diagnostic and Radiological Services See details

Humana USAA Honor Giveback (Regional PPO) covers diagnostic and radiological services, offering lab services and outpatient X-rays with no copay. Diagnostic tests require a $0 to $50 copay and 25% coinsurance, while diagnostic radiological services have a copay up to $335, and therapeutic radiological services carry a $40 copay and 20% coinsurance.

Home Health Services See details

Home Health Services are covered under the Humana USAA Honor Giveback (Regional PPO) with no copay and no coinsurance. Prior authorization is required to receive these services.

Cardiac Rehabilitation Services See details

Humana USAA Honor Giveback (Regional PPO) does not cover cardiac rehabilitation services, as all sub-services, including intensive cardiac rehabilitation, pulmonary rehabilitation, and supervised exercise therapy (SET) for symptomatic peripheral artery disease (PAD), are not covered.

Skilled Nursing Facility (SNF) See details

Skilled Nursing Facility (SNF) services are partially covered by the Humana USAA Honor Giveback (Regional PPO) plan, requiring a $10 daily copay for days 1 to 20 and a $218 daily copay for days 21 to 100, with no coinsurance. Prior authorization is required, and additional days beyond the standard Medicare-covered limit are not covered.

Other Services See details

Humana USAA Honor Giveback (Regional PPO) covers several additional services, including acupuncture for a $40 copay and no coinsurance, alongside meal benefits and over-the-counter items with no copay and no coinsurance. Dual Eligible SNPs with Highly Integrated Services are not covered under this plan.
